    For the past three years that my son has attended Boys & Girls Club Tustin, we have had nothing but…read moregood experiences with the program. Our son had a great time in the Little Rascals program as a Kindergartener and continues to express how much he enjoys coming to the Club. He has so many opportunities to engage in different activities, learn new skills and sports, and play with friends. Although some of the program rooms are smaller, there seems to be an adequate variety of options the kids have to chose from to participate in. Our son always comes home telling us about new things he's had the opportunity to do. I will be honest that I had concerns at first regarding my child's safety, as it is not considered a child care center, but rather, an after-school enrichment program (so there are not strict sign-in/ sign-out policies). However, since enrolling, we have had no concerns with safety. The staffing is pretty consistent and therefore becomes very familiar with each child and their needs. We also have continuing conversations with our son regarding safety. Overall, we have been very satisfied with our experience at the Boys and Girls Club Tustin. It is enjoyable for the kids and it is an affordable option for working families.

    We had my daughter's 9th birthday at Lil Chef this past weekend, and it was such a hit. The two…read morechefs running the party were awesome--funny, super interactive with the kids, and on top of every detail. They handled things I didn't even realize I didn't have to do--like setting up the goodie bags, cutting and serving the cake, packing leftovers--which meant I actually got to relax and enjoy the party. The kids had a blast making their own pizzas and decorating cupcakes, and the fact that the place comes already decorated with birthday banners and permanent balloons made it even easier. Plus, being able to bring in our own food and drinks (including alcohol!) for the adults was a huge bonus. Everyone kept commenting on what a fun and unique party it was. If you're planning to do goodie bags, I recommend ordering aprons on Amazon instead of buying them from the venue--it's cheaper and makes for a cute party favor. Also, I suggest putting a balloon on the directional signs in the shopping center by Dunkin' Donuts so your guests don't get lost, since it's a bit tricky to get there. Highly recommend Lil Chef if you want a fun, stress-free, and memorable birthday party.
